Ref: AT0518- The Old Carpenter's Shop is a charming detached three-bedroom modern home, tucked away within the picturesque hamlet of Hillhead, near St Stephen, in the heart of Mid Cornwall. Thoughtfully and sympathetically designed to reflect the character and appearance of a traditional Cornish cottage, the property offers an attractive blend of timeless charm and modern-day comfort. Named after the former carpenter's shop that is said to have once occupied the site, this delightful home enjoys a unique sense of history and individuality.
Occupying an enviable position, the property commands far-reaching countryside views and benefits from adjoining open farmland, creating a wonderful feeling of space and tranquillity. Internally, the well-proportioned accommodation includes a welcoming living room centred around a wood-burner, a distinctive open-plan kitchen and dining area designed for both everyday family life and entertaining, a practical utility porch, a ground floor shower room, a family bathroom, and the added comfort of oil-fired central heating.
Outside, the attractive gardens have been thoughtfully landscaped with decked seating areas and lawns, perfectly positioned to enjoy the surrounding rural outlook. A range of useful timber outbuildings and a charming summerhouse provide excellent versatility for storage, hobbies or home working, while a generous driveway offers off-road parking for approximately three to four vehicles.
Despite its rural setting, The Old Carpenter's Shop is conveniently located just a short distance from the popular village of St Stephen, which offers a good range of everyday amenities including shops, a primary and secondary school, healthcare facilities and a public house. Its central Mid Cornwall location also provides excellent access to the north and south coasts, the Eden Project, and the nearby towns of St Austell, Newquay and Bodmin, making it an ideal choice for those seeking an idyllic countryside lifestyle without compromising on convenience.
